Resolume Arena
Resolume Arena is a video mapping software designed for real-time video manipulation and projection mapping. It offers advanced tools for creating dynamic visual performances, catering to artists, creators, and professionals in the media and design industry.
Resolume Arena enables users to create and manipulate video content in real-time for projection mapping and visual performances.

CapCut
CapCut is a video editing and image design platform known for its user-friendly interface and advanced features, making it ideal for content creators, influencers, and hobbyists looking to enhance their media projects.
CapCut is a platform for video editing and image design, offering tools for content creation and enhancement.
